Our Metric Viton O-Rings are precision-engineered for specialized applications, following metric dimensions for a perfect fit. Made from high-grade Viton material, these O-rings boast exceptional mechanical properties, including a Shore A hardness of 75 and a wide operating temperature range of -10°F to +300°F. Designed for rapid recovery and superior memory, these O-rings meet stringent industry standards for performance and durability.
